Wardlow, a former three-time AEW TNT Champion, hasn’t graced AEW television screens since his championship loss to Luchasaurus on AEW Collision’s debut episode in June. This extended absence has left fans speculating about his whereabouts and eagerly anticipating his return.
During a recent WrestleDream media scrum, Tony Khan addressed Wardlow’s status within the company and provided insight into his anticipated comeback. He stated:
